    There is lots of stuff on the bay. Although, you will end up paying as much (or more) for a set as if you find a complete plane in the wild (garage sale, flea market, craigslist). There are also reproduction knobs and totes , of varying quality, that show up online often. You will save a bit of money if you are willing to repair cracked totes. It's easy if the crack is clean and has not been worn down or missing major pieces.

    There is a low knob and high knob. Some have a raised ring at the base, later planes are made with a raised ring cast into the plane. I do not have access to my book right now but I think there are three different kinds of knobs. There are 4 different kinds of totes I think; #1 size is very small, #2 is a little bigger, #3 and #4 are standard size with only one attachment hole for the post, and #5 through #8 have a little longer base with a hole for a screw at the toe of the tote. The actual shape of the tote changed some over time with the longer horn being earlier but I think they fit regardless.
